Evolution of dimensions: why cars are getting bigger

An analysis of the auto industry over the past 30 years shows a steady increase in the physical size of cars. This phenomenon is called "class inflation", when a new generation model becomes longer and wider than its predecessor, while formally remaining in the same class. The main drivers of this process are safety requirements and the desire of manufacturers to add more comfort.

Modern crash test standards dictate the need for large crumple zones, which automatically increases the length of the body. In addition, there must be enough space inside the cabin to install complex passive safety systems, airbags and powerful pillars. All this leads to the fact that average length the car is growing faster than technical needs require.

  • πŸ“ Increased wheelbase for improved stability at high speeds.
  • πŸ›‘οΈ Extension of the body to install more powerful side members and side beams.
  • πŸ’Ί Increase in average weight and dimensions of passengers, requiring a more spacious interior.

In parallel with the length, the width also increases. Wide wheels are necessary to improve handling and accommodate large rims, which are now standard even for budget models. However, this creates problems: average size car The width often exceeds the standard parameters of doors in old garages.

Standard classification and actual sizes

To systematize data in the automotive industry, a European classification has been adopted, which divides vehicles into segments from A to F. Although the boundaries between them are blurred, the average dimensions of each class allow us to form an overall picture. Understanding these differences helps when choosing a car for specific tasks.

The most popular segment today is the C-class, which includes popular compact models. It is they who form the very β€œaverage size” that is felt on public roads. However, we cannot ignore the growing share of crossovers, which are often based on passenger car platforms, but have increased ground clearance and dimensions.

Below is a table showing the average parameters of various classes. It is worth considering that these values ​​may vary depending on the specific model and year of manufacture.

Class Body type Average length (mm) Average width without mirrors (mm)
A (extra small) Hatchback 3500-3800 1600-1650
B (small) Hatchback/Sedan 3900-4200 1680-1720
C (golf class) Hatchback/Station wagon 4300-4500 1750-1800
D (medium) Sedan/Leafback 4600-4800 1800-1850

Please note that the width in the table does not include rear view mirrors. In reality overall width the car is always 200-300 mm larger. This is a critical consideration when calculating the width of the entrance to a garage or parking space.

The influence of body type on dimensions

The body type determines not only the appearance, but also the volume distribution. Sedans tend to be longer than hatchbacks in the same class due to the presence of a protruding trunk. This affects the turning radius and the convenience of parking in conditions of limited β€œpocket” space.

Station wagons and crossovers are often the same length as sedans, but differ in height and vertical rear overhang. Crossovers may be visually more massive due to plastic linings and increased ground clearance, although their actual body width often coincides with donor models.

When choosing a car for a dense city, many drivers prefer short overhangs. This allows for more efficient use of parking space. However, it's worth remembering that a shorter body often means less trunk space, which can be inconvenient for family trips.

⚠️ Attention: When installing a roof rack or tow bar, the overall length of the vehicle increases. Make sure that this does not violate parking rules or interfere with reversing.

Why do crossovers appear wider than sedans?

Crossovers often have taller and wider wheel arches, as well as vertical sidewalls, which visually and physically increase the space they take up compared to streamlined sedans.

Parking standards and reality

There is a gap between regulations and the actual situation on the roads. According to current SNiP and GOST, the width of a standard parking space is 2.5 meters. It would seem that this is enough, because average width car about 1.8 meters.

However, these calculations do not take into account the need to open doors for passengers to exit. If you park two modern crossovers with a width of 1.95 meters close to the markings, it will be physically impossible to open the door between them without damaging the neighboring car. That is why in new residential complexes they make spaces 2.7-3 meters wide.

  • πŸ…ΏοΈ Standard space: 2.5 m (often not enough for wide cars).
  • πŸš— Disabled space: 3.6 m (necessary for boarding with a stroller).
  • 🏒 Underground parking: often already above ground due to columns and ventilation.

Drivers of large vehicles are advised to look for seats at the edge of the row or special extended areas. Trying to squeeze a wide car into a standard seat may leave you unable to get out of the car yourself or let your children out.

Dimensions and handling in the city

The size of the car directly affects its maneuverability. Long vehicles have greater inertia and require a wider turning radius. In narrow city streets this can be a problem, especially if you need to turn around in one go.

The width of the car affects the driver's sense of size. On wide cars it is more difficult to feel the extreme points of the body, which requires getting used to and having high-quality vision systems. Parktronics and all-round cameras have ceased to be a luxury and have become a necessity for D-class cars and above.

It is also worth considering the height. Low sports sedans easily fit under height restrictions in underground parking lots, while tall SUVs can hit ventilation ducts or barriers. Always pay attention to height restriction signs when entering underground structures.

⚠️ Warning: Don't rely on parking sensors alone. They may not notice thin bollards or low-lying bumpers from nearby cars. Always monitor your surroundings visually.

How to Measure Your Car Accurately

If you are planning to buy a garage, carport, or just want to be sure of your capabilities, it is better to measure the car yourself. Data on the Internet may differ from reality, especially if non-standard elements are installed on the machine.

To measure, you will need a tape measure at least 5 meters long and an assistant. It is important to measure the car in running order, but without excess cargo in the trunk, which could change the ground clearance. Pay special attention to the most prominent points.

Measure the width of the mirrors when they are open - this is often the widest parameter. Also check the height in relation to the antenna or roof rails. Write down the data received and save it in your phone; it can be useful when planning trips or purchasing accessories.

What to do if the car does not fit into the garage?

You might consider installing folding mirrors, replacing side mirrors with smaller models, or rethinking the storage layout inside your garage.

What class of cars is considered the most popular in the world?

Today the most popular class is the C-class (golf class). It is in this segment that the largest number of models from different manufacturers are concentrated, as they offer the optimal balance between size, cost and comfort for the family.

Does the color of a car affect the perception of its size?

Yes, light colors (white, silver) visually enlarge the object, making the car larger. Dark colors (black, dark blue) hide the volume, and the car seems smaller and more compact than it actually is.

Why are American cars often wider than European ones?

This is due to historical road standards. In the US, roads are wider and parking spaces are more spacious, so manufacturers could afford to make bodies wider for comfort. In Europe, narrow streets dictated the need for compactness.

Is it possible to change the dimensions of a car legally?

Installation of non-standard bumpers, arch extensions or spoilers that change the dimensions by more than 50 mm requires modifications to the design and registration with the traffic police. Simply changing the rims to wider ones may also be considered illegal.
